本発明は、天板角度調整構造を有するベッドサイドテーブルに関する。特に、天板の角度調整に便利で、かつ好適な位置決め性及び支持の安定性を持つテーブルに関する。 The present invention relates to a bedside table having a top plate angle adjusting structure. In particular, the present invention relates to a table that is convenient for adjusting the angle of the top plate and has suitable positioning and support stability.

従来の、ベッドサイドに置くことができるテーブルは、主に直立かつ移動可能な支持脚を備え、支持脚の上方に天板を横向きに設ける。また、患者又は身体不自由の方がベッド上で食事をとることができるように、天板をベッドの上方の位置に対応させる。 A conventional table that can be placed on the bedside is mainly provided with upright and movable support legs, and a top plate is provided sideways above the support legs. Also, the top plate should be positioned above the bed so that the patient or the physically handicapped can eat on the bed.

しかしながら、使用者がベッド上で読書しようとする時、該天板が水平であり、読書に適しない。 However, when the user tries to read on the bed, the top plate is horizontal and is not suitable for reading.

このため、現在では天板の角度を調整できるベッドサイドテーブルがある。
例えば、特許文献1の寝台用テーブルは、支持脚の伸縮管の上方に複数の位置決め穴が設けられ、該天板の下方に支持具が設けられ、該支持具の一端が逆凹型の支持具受けに接合して伸縮管の上方と枢着する。また、支持具受けの上に位置決め穴と接合できる位置決めピンが設けられ、天板を支持具受けによって伸縮管に対応して枢動させ、角度を調整してから位置決めピンと角度対応の位置決め穴を接合することによって位置決めを行うことができる。
For this reason, there are now bedside tables that can adjust the angle of the top plate.
For example, the sleeper table of Patent Document 1 is provided with a plurality of positioning holes above the expansion tube of the support leg, a support is provided below the top plate, and one end of the support is a reverse concave support. It is joined to the receiver and pivotally attached to the upper part of the telescopic tube. In addition, a positioning pin that can be joined to the positioning hole is provided on the support holder, and the top plate is pivoted according to the expansion tube by the support holder, and after adjusting the angle, the positioning pin and the positioning hole corresponding to the angle are formed. Positioning can be performed by joining.

台湾特許公告第447272号Taiwan Patent Notice No. 447272

ところが、前記寝台用テーブルの前記天板は、僅かに支持具受けのみを枢着点として伸縮管と枢着するだけ、というしくみのため、支持の安定性が悪い。また、該位置決め穴が直接露出されるため、全体的な組立性が悪いという欠陥がある。 However, the top plate of the sleeper table has a mechanism in which it is pivotally attached to the expansion tube with only the support holder as the pivot point, so that the support is not stable. Further, since the positioning hole is directly exposed, there is a defect that the overall assembling property is poor.

本発明は、前述の従来のベッドサイドテーブルが持つ、天板角度が調整できないまたは調整しにくい、支持の安定性ならびに組立性が悪いといった欠陥を解決し、簡単に天板の角度を調整でき、好適な位置決め性及び支持の安定性及び全体性を持つベッドサイドテーブルを提供することを目的とする。 The present invention solves the above-mentioned defects of the conventional bedside table, such as the top plate angle cannot be adjusted or is difficult to adjust, and the support stability and assembling property are poor, and the top plate angle can be easily adjusted. It is an object of the present invention to provide a bedside table having suitable positioning and support stability and overallity.

本発明の位置決め棒は、弾性部材の弾性力を介して位置決め端を位置決め穴に挿入させて天板の角度を固定できる。
また、位置決め棒を引っ張ることで位置決め端を位置決め穴から離脱させることができ、かつ同時に弾性体を圧縮し、2つの枢着座が軸棒で2つの軸座に対して回転させることができる。
さらに該2つの枢着座の当り面は2つの軸座の当接面と当接支持できるため、二重に支持の安定性の効果を奏する。
また、天板角度調整後、位置決め棒の把持端を手放した時、位置決め棒が弾性部材の弾性力を介して位置決め端を別の位置決め穴に挿入させて固定できるため、好適な天板角度調整の利便性の効果を奏する。
In the positioning rod of the present invention, the positioning end can be inserted into the positioning hole via the elastic force of the elastic member to fix the angle of the top plate.
Further, the positioning end can be separated from the positioning hole by pulling the positioning rod, and at the same time, the elastic body can be compressed and the two pivot seats can be rotated with respect to the two shaft seats by the shaft rod.
Further, since the contact surfaces of the two pivot seats can be contact-supported with the contact surfaces of the two axle seats, the effect of double support stability is achieved.
Further, when the gripping end of the positioning rod is released after adjusting the top plate angle, the positioning rod can be fixed by inserting the positioning end into another positioning hole via the elastic force of the elastic member, so that the top plate angle adjustment is suitable. It has the effect of convenience.
